THE IMITATION OF CHRIST is the 2nd Most Widely Read Spiritual Book after the Bible. It's about the deep feelings and experiences of a heart that yearns to please the Most High God. It speaks to the soul of every Christian, reminding them of the fleeting nature of earthly joy and the eternity of happiness with God.
